Diana West writes a weekly column that appears in many newspapers, including the Washington Times every Friday. She has written essays for numerous publications, including The Wall Street Journal, The New Criterion, The Public interest, The Weekly Standard, and The Washington Post Magazine, and her fiction has appeared in the Atlantic Monthly. She is also a regular contributor to CNN's "Lou Dobbs Tonight" and "Lou Dobbs This Week."
